Kind of short notice, but there will be a streamed race to the Light World ending + Cotton Alley starting in roughly 2 hours (currently scheduled for 4:22 EDT).  The race will be between myself and another full game speedrunner by the name of joe, we're hoping to get through inside of 35 minutes.

This is a part of a much larger game marathon put on by http://speeddemosarchive.com called Japan Relief Done Quick.  It'll be running all weekend and will feature some of the best players out there blazing through some great games.  We're raising money for Doctors Without Borders and have a bunch of cool prizes for donors.  So swing by and check it out, and maybe donate a little money to a good cause while you're at it.

Full schedule of games can be seen at:  http://speeddemosarchive.com/marathon/schedule/

I thought I would use this thread to point out that there are live races sometimes played (not for charity anymore, afaik) at #speedrunslive@irc.speeddemosarchive.com (IRC).

Most of the time, these are "any %" races using Meat Boy, that means you must beat Dr Fetus, and are allowed to skip 3 levels per world.

I have been streaming my past races on ustream like many other SRL members do, but it's not required. You can play on console or PC.
My current "any %" time is about an hour, which, like you can guess, isn't *that* fast.
Anyone can join.

I hope some of you come by so that we could organize more SMB races :)
